Example #1
0
 public ILoadBalancerTargetProps AddEc2ServiceToNetworkTargetGroup(IService service, INetworkTargetGroup targetGroup, string containerName, double containerPort)
 {
     return(HandlerResources.AwsCdkEcsHandler.AddEc2ServiceToNetworkTargetGroup(service, targetGroup, containerName, containerPort));
 }
Example #2
0
        public ILoadBalancerTargetProps AddEc2ServiceToNetworkTargetGroup(IService service, INetworkTargetGroup targetGroup, string containerName, double containerPort)
        {
            var castedService = service as Ec2Service;

            var result = castedService.LoadBalancerTarget(new LoadBalancerTargetOptions
            {
                ContainerName = containerName,
                ContainerPort = containerPort
            })
                         .AttachToNetworkTargetGroup(targetGroup);

            return(result);
        }